"""Streamlit web UI for obs-agent.
Usage
-----
streamlit run app.py
Then open the URL shown in the terminal (typically http://localhost:8501).
You can pass the provider and model as query parameters:
http://localhost:8501/?provider=deepseek&model=deepseek-chat
Environment variables:
DEEPSEEK_API_KEY — required for DeepSeek (default provider)
ANTHROPIC_API_KEY — required for Anthropic
"""
import os
import streamlit as st
from agent import run, stream_run
# ── Page config ────────────────────────────────────────────────────────
st.set_page_config(
page_title="obs-agent — Multi-Cloud Cost Triage",
page_icon="☁️",
layout="wide",
initial_sidebar_state="expanded",
)
# ── Sidebar ────────────────────────────────────────────────────────────
st.sidebar.title("☁️ obs-agent")
st.sidebar.caption("Multi-Cloud Cost Triage Agent")
provider = st.sidebar.selectbox(
"Provider",
options=["anthropic", "deepseek", "ollama"],
index=1,
help="LLM provider to use for answering questions. DeepSeek is the default; Ollama runs locally (no API key).",
)
model = st.sidebar.text_input(
"Model (optional)",
placeholder="e.g. claude-sonnet-4-6, deepseek-chat, or llama3.2",
help="Leave blank for provider default.",
)
use_streaming = st.sidebar.checkbox(
"Stream responses",
value=True,
help="Show tokens as they arrive instead of waiting for the full answer.",
)
st.sidebar.divider()
st.sidebar.markdown("**Example questions:**")
st.sidebar.markdown("- Which Azure subscription has the highest overage cost?")
st.sidebar.markdown("- Show me the top 3 GCP projects")
st.sidebar.markdown("- Compare costs across Azure and GCP")
st.sidebar.markdown("- Any cost spikes above 200%?")
st.sidebar.markdown("- What's the daily trend for sub-a1b2c3d4?")
st.sidebar.divider()
with st.sidebar.expander("ℹ️ About"):
st.markdown(
"Answers questions about cloud logging costs across "
"**Azure** and **GCP** by calling tools over synthetic "
"billing data. Built with Claude/DeepSeek tool-use API."
)
# ── API key check ──────────────────────────────────────────────────────
if provider == "ollama":
st.sidebar.info("🟢 Ollama — runs locally, no API key needed")
elif provider == "deepseek" and not os.environ.get("DEEPSEEK_API_KEY"):
st.sidebar.error("❌ `DEEPSEEK_API_KEY` not set in environment.")
elif provider == "anthropic" and not os.environ.get("ANTHROPIC_API_KEY"):
st.sidebar.error("❌ `ANTHROPIC_API_KEY` not set in environment.")
else:
st.sidebar.success(f"✅ {provider.title()} API key detected")
# ── Main chat ──────────────────────────────────────────────────────────
st.title("☁️ Multi-Cloud Cost Triage")
st.caption(
f"Provider: **{provider}**"
+ (f" · Model: **{model}**" if model else "")
+ (" · Streaming" if use_streaming else "")
)
if "messages" not in st.session_state:
st.session_state.messages = []
for msg in st.session_state.messages:
with st.chat_message(msg["role"]):
st.markdown(msg["content"])
if prompt := st.chat_input("Ask a question about cloud costs..."):
st.session_state.messages.append({"role": "user", "content": prompt})
with st.chat_message("user"):
st.markdown(prompt)
with st.chat_message("assistant"):
try:
model_arg = model if model else None
history = st.session_state.get("_agent_history")
if use_streaming:
holder: dict = {}
st.write_stream(stream_run(
prompt,
provider=provider,
model=model_arg,
verbose=True,
messages=history,
result_holder=holder,
))
answer = holder["answer"]
st.session_state["_agent_history"] = holder["messages"]
else:
with st.spinner("Agent is thinking..."):
answer, updated = run(
prompt,
provider=provider,
model=model_arg,
verbose=True,
messages=history,
)
st.markdown(answer)
st.session_state["_agent_history"] = updated
st.session_state.messages.append(
{"role": "assistant", "content": answer}
)
except Exception as e:
error_msg = f"Error: {e}"
st.error(error_msg)
st.session_state.messages.append(
{"role": "assistant", "content": error_msg}
)
